Which seats will fit?

Just picked up an 89 Civic hatch and the seats are destroyed.
Can anybody tell me if there are any other types pf seats which will fit beside the racing seats.

Re: Which seats will fit?

custom rails are almost always needed for seat swaps.. for some reason, Honda decided they didn't want you swapping seats... hell with engines, just can't have the seats.

Hatch seats, yes, CRX seats if you change the seat pan or the whole back, any other seat you want if you make the rails fit, which isn't hard.
